A lively handwritten script with a brush-pen character and pronounced thick–thin modulation. Letterforms are tall and compact, with a narrow overall footprint and rhythmic, slightly irregular stroke endings that mimic pressure and lift-off. The uppercase set mixes print-like simplicity with soft curves, while the lowercase leans more cursive, featuring frequent loops on ascenders/descenders and occasional soft connections. Counters are small and openings can be tight, contributing to a compact, vertical texture in text.
Well suited to short-to-medium display copy where a friendly handwritten voice is desirable—greeting cards, invitations, quote graphics, packaging labels, and casual branding accents. It can also work for headings and pull quotes, while very small sizes may benefit from generous tracking due to the compact forms and tight counters.
The font reads warm and personable, like quick, confident hand lettering on cards or labels. Its bouncy curves and looped strokes give it a cheerful, crafty tone rather than a formal calligraphic one.
Designed to emulate casual brush script lettering with a narrow, upright stance and expressive contrast, aiming for an approachable handmade look that remains legible in display settings.
In longer lines, the strong vertical emphasis and tight internal spaces create a dense, energetic color. Numerals follow the same hand-drawn logic, with rounded shapes and varied stroke contrast that keeps them consistent with the letters.
